New York: Former US President Donald Trump has been fined $5,000 for violating court orders.
According to a foreign news agency, the US court stopped former US President Donald Trump from insulting the court staff in the New York civil trial, while the video of Donald Trump's verbal attack on the court staff went viral.
Despite a court order to remove the video, it remained uploaded on Donald Trump's website.
A US court ruled that doing so in the future could result in severe sanctions and imprisonment.
